Excel如何获取数列?如何快速提取?
作者:佚名|分类:EXCEL|浏览:101|发布时间:2025-04-15 01:12:47
Excel如何获取数列?如何快速提取?
在Excel中,处理数据时经常需要获取数列,无论是进行数据分析、统计还是图表制作,数列的获取都是基础且重要的步骤。以下将详细介绍如何在Excel中获取数列,以及如何快速提取数列。
一、Excel中获取数列的方法
1. 手动输入法
这是获取数列最直接的方法。在Excel单元格中,直接输入数列的起始值,然后利用Excel的自动填充功能来生成数列。
例如,如果你想在A1单元格中输入数列1, 2, 3,你可以在A1中输入1,然后选中A1单元格,将鼠标移至单元格右下角的填充句柄,当鼠标变成黑色十字时,按住鼠标左键向下拖动,直到你想要填充的数列长度。
2. 公式法
使用Excel的公式功能可以创建更复杂的数列,如等差数列、等比数列等。
对于等差数列,可以使用公式`=A1+1`来获取下一个数。
对于等比数列,可以使用公式`=A1*2`来获取下一个数。
3. 序列对话框
通过“序列”对话框,可以设置更复杂的数列参数,如步长、终止值等。
选择需要填充数列的单元格,点击“开始”选项卡中的“编辑”组,然后选择“填充”下的“序列”。
在弹出的“序列”对话框中,选择序列类型(如等差序列、等比序列等),设置起始值、步长、终止值等参数,点击“确定”即可。
二、如何快速提取数列
1. 使用“查找和替换”功能
当你有一个包含数列的单元格区域时,可以使用“查找和替换”功能来快速提取数列。
选中包含数列的单元格区域,点击“开始”选项卡中的“编辑”组,然后选择“查找和替换”。
在“查找和替换”对话框中,选择“查找”选项卡,输入数列的第一个值,点击“查找下一个”。
重复点击“查找下一个”,直到找到数列的最后一个值。
2. 使用VBA宏
对于需要频繁提取数列的场景,可以使用VBA宏来自动化这个过程。
打开Excel的“开发者”选项卡,点击“Visual Basic”来打开VBA编辑器。
在VBA编辑器中,插入一个新的模块,然后编写宏代码来提取数列。
运行宏,即可自动提取数列。
三、相关问答
1. 问答:如何获取等差数列的公差?
回答: 如果你知道等差数列的第一个数和第二个数,可以通过以下公式计算公差:公差 = 第二个数 第一个数。
2. 问答:如何获取等比数列的公比?
回答: 如果你知道等比数列的第一个数和第二个数,可以通过以下公式计算公比:公比 = 第二个数 / 第一个数。
3. 问答:Excel中如何快速查找特定的数列?
回答: 你可以使用Excel的“查找和替换”功能,在“查找”选项卡中输入数列的起始值,然后按“查找下一个”来定位数列。
4. 问答:VBA宏中如何提取数列?
回答: 在VBA中,你可以使用循环和数组来提取数列。以下是一个简单的示例代码:
```vba
Sub ExtractSequence()
Dim startValue As Double
Dim stepValue As Double
Dim sequence() As Double
Dim i As Integer
startValue = 1 ' 数列的起始值
stepValue = 1 ' 数列的步长
ReDim sequence(1 To 10) ' 假设我们提取10个数
For i = 1 To 10
sequence(i) = startValue + (i 1) * stepValue
Next i
' 打印数列
For i = 1 To 10
Debug.Print sequence(i)
Next i
End Sub
```
运行此宏将提取一个等差数列并打印出来。